COMMODE

Estimate £1,100 - £1,500

Plus 26.4% buyers premium inclusive of VAT

19th century French Louis Philippe flame mahogany with five long drawers (including a plinth drawer) and St Annes variegated grey marble top, 124cm x 55cm x 92cm H.
